<br />EXHIBIT A <br />Resolution No. PC-91-88 <br />conditions of Approval <br /> <br />Case PUD-89-6-4M <br /> <br />1. The proposed development shall conform sUbstantially to the <br />site plans, elevations, and related materials, Exhibit A <br />(dated "Received October 31, 1991"), on file with the Planning <br />Department, except as modified by these conditions. <br /> <br />2. The developer shall obtain all building and other applicable <br />city permits for the project prior to the commencement of <br />construction. <br /> <br />3. The applicant shall submit a landscape plan for the Santa Rita <br />Road frontage of Rose Pavilion -Phase III that shows the <br />location and species of sixteen 24" box trees to be planted as <br />a replacement for the sixteen trees which were to have been <br />relocated. This location plan and the proposed species shall <br />be submitted for the review and approval by the Planning <br />Director prior to the issuance of a building permit. <br /> <br />4. <br /> <br />The proposed signs for the <br />comprehensive sign program <br />Pavilion - Phase III, on file <br /> <br />project shall adhere to the <br />previously-adopted for Rose <br />with the Planning Department. <br /> <br />5. The development plan for Rose Pavilion - Phase III shall <br />include a pad for a 6,650 square foot restaurant in the area <br />shown as the location of the Sizzler restaurant. The <br />architectural and landscape architectural design for the <br />sizzler restaurant is excluded from this design review <br />approval and any subsequent design for a restaurant in this <br />location must be submitted for the review and approval by the <br />Design Review Board prior to the issuance of building permits <br />for the restaurant. <br /> <br />6. The applicant shall reduce the glare from the parking lot <br />lights by adding shields directing the light away from the <br />adjacent residence at 3596 Chippendale Court. The shields <br />shall be installed prior to issuance of building permits for <br />any of the three proposed buildings, to the satisfaction of <br />the Planning Director and the adjacent neighbor. <br /> <br />In addition, the applicant shall negotiate in good faith with <br />the management of Garcia's Restaurant and Outdoor World, and <br />shall require on the pad restaurant and southern elevation of <br />the Goodyear building, that the tenant signage be turned off <br />at the close of business each day. <br />
